Abstract
This study, conducted within the PilotSTRATEGY project, explores the optimization of CO₂ injection under geological uncertainties in the Q4-TV1 prospect of the offshore Lusitanian Basin, Portugal. A static model integrating seismic and well data was coupled with dynamic simulations in the Big Loop framework, combining Bayesian optimization with uncertainty analysis. Geological risks, including intersecting faults and legacy wells, were evaluated to ensure safe containment and reservoir integrity. The integrated workflow identified an optimal injection strategy that minimizes leakage risks while ensuring stable plume behavior over the long term. The results demonstrate the value of combining Bayesian optimization and dynamic modelling to design secure and efficient CCUS injection strategies in geologically complex settings.
